Construction projects vary widely, and buyers commonly face cost ranges based on building type, site conditions, and finish quality. The following cost guide presents typical US prices and clear drivers behind the price. The focus is on the cost to construct a new building from ground up, including site work, structure, systems, and finishes.
Notes on price ranges: ranges use USD and reflect common market conditions. Assumptions include mid-range finishes, standard permits, and typical labor productivity.
| Item | Low | Average | High | Notes |
|---|---|---|---|---|
| Land & Site Prep | $20,000 | $60,000 | $225,000 | Includes site access, grading, utilities connection. |
| Foundation & Structure | $100,000 | $260,000 | $900,000 | Depends on soil, footing type, and framing material. |
| Exterior & Roofing | $40,000 | $140,000 | $450,000 | Cladding, windows, roof assembly, drainage. |
| Interior Finishes | $60,000 | $180,000 | $700,000 | Drywall, flooring, paint, cabinets, fixtures. |
| MEP Systems | $50,000 | $150,000 | $550,000 | Mechanical, electrical, plumbing, HVAC. |
| Permits & Fees | $5,000 | $25,000 | $100,000 | Depends on jurisdiction and project scope. |
| Contingency & Overhead | $20,000 | $60,000 | $200,000 | Typically 5–15% of Hard Costs. |
| Total Project | $300,000 | $1,000,000 | $4,000,000 | Assumes a modest, single-building shell with standard finishes. |
Overview Of Costs
Typical cost range to build a basic commercial or residential building starts around $200-$300 per square foot for low-end finishes in rural markets and can exceed $500-$700 per square foot in high-cost urban areas with premium materials. For mid-range builds, expect about $250-$350 per sq ft up to 6,000 sq ft, with larger footprints benefiting from economies of scale. When estimating total project costs, consider both total project ranges and per-unit ranges to reflect site complexity and design choices. Cost Breakdown
Below is a representative table of major cost buckets used in building projects, with typical US ranges and notes.
| Cost Category | Low | Average | High | Typical per-sq ft | Notes |
|---|---|---|---|---|---|
| Materials | $60,000 | $180,000 | $700,000 | $80-$180 | Concrete, steel, framing, insulation, finishes. Material costs fluctuate with commodity markets. |
| Labor | $70,000 | $210,000 | $900,000 | $15-$50 | Wages, benefits, and productivity for crews; varies by region and trade. |
| Equipment | $5,000 | $40,000 | $150,000 | $2-$6 | Rental or depreciation of heavy machinery on site. |
| Permits | $5,000 | $25,000 | $100,000 | — | Local approvals, impact fees, and inspections. |
| Delivery / Disposal | $3,000 | $15,000 | $50,000 | — | Site delivery, debris removal, recycling costs. |
| Warranty & Overhead | $6,000 | $20,000 | $80,000 | — | General contractor overhead, warranties, project management. |
| Taxes | $4,000 | $18,000 | $70,000 | — | Property and materials taxes, if applicable. |

What Drives Price
Key drivers include foundation type, building size, and finish quality. A deeper foundation (slab vs crawlspace vs full basement) adds substantial cost. Building size changes cost nonlinearly through economies of scale and logistics. Finish quality, from basic to premium, affects interior materials, fixtures, and acoustic treatment. Site conditions such as slope, drainage, and soil bearing capacity strongly influence earthwork and foundation choices.
Regional Price Differences
Regional variations can shift total cost by ±20–40%. Urban cores typically run higher due to labor rates, permits, and material access, while Rural areas may be cheaper but longer lead times exist. The following snapshot highlights three common market types:
- Urban/Coastal: higher permit fees, skilled labor demand; +20% to +40% vs national average.
- Suburban: balanced costs; near-average to slightly above-average depending on land value; roughly ±0% to +15%.
- Rural/Tier 3: lower labor costs, but longer construction windows and logistics; −5% to −25% relative to national average.
Labor, Hours & Rates
Labor rates vary by region and trade; typical ranges are $40-$90 per hour for general trades, with specialty trades (HVAC, electrical) often higher. Install time scales with building size and complexity. A 2,000-sq-ft basic shell might require 8–12 weeks of on-site labor, while larger, higher-end projects can extend well beyond that. Extra & Hidden Costs
Hidden costs can alter the budget by 5–15% if not planned. Examples include temporary utilities, on-site security, design changes, and long lead-time material delays. Seasonal weather can also affect labor efficiency and project duration. Always include a contingency line of 5–15% based on risk assessment and permitting uncertainty.
Cost Compared To Alternatives
Alternatives to new-build projects include remodels, additions, or prefab modules, each with distinct price profiles. Remodels may leverage existing structures to reduce site work but often encounter unforeseen conditions, increasing soft costs. Prefab or modular options can deliver faster timelines and cost predictability, but may constrain design flexibility. The choice depends on site, timing, and required finish levels.
Real-World Pricing Examples
Three scenario cards illustrate typical quotes for mid-market projects in diverse markets.
- Basic — 2,000 sq ft, mid-range finishes, slab foundation, standard electrical/plumbing, simple exterior. Labor: 2–3 crews, 8–10 weeks onsite. Total: $500,000–$750,000; $250–$375 per sq ft.
- Mid-Range — 3,500 sq ft, moderate upgrades, crawlspace, enhanced insulation, energy-efficient windows, mid-tier interior. Labor: 4–6 crews, 14–20 weeks. Total: $1,100,000–$1,900,000; $315–$550 per sq ft.
- Premium — 5,000 sq ft, premium finishes, full basement, complex MEP, upscale materials. Labor: larger teams, 24–40 weeks. Total: $2,500,000–$4,000,000; $500–$800 per sq ft.

Maintenance & Ownership Costs
Five-year cost outlook matters for total ownership. Maintenance, insurance, and potential future renovations add to lifetime cost. A well-built shell with quality systems typically reduces long-term maintenance surprises. Estimated 5-year maintenance can range from 2–6% of initial project cost, depending on climate and equipment choices.
Seasonality & Price Trends
Prices tend to be lower in off-peak construction seasons (late fall and winter in many markets) due to softer demand. Lead times for materials may tighten during peak seasons, pushing some costs higher. Access to skilled labor also shifts with regional project waves, which can alter bids by a few percent month-to-month.
Permits, Codes & Rebates
Permits and code compliance add both upfront and ongoing costs. Local rebates or incentives for energy efficiency can offset some of the initial outlay. Permit complexity depends on building type, height, and zoning. Builders often incorporate permit fees into initial bids, but it’s wise to verify coverage of inspections and potential amendments.
